Procurement Specialist Overview:
The Procurement Specialist leads supplier management, sourcing strategy, and procurement activities for complex commodities, operational categories, or strategic suppliers. Negotiates complex agreements, manages supplier performance initiatives, and identifies opportunities for cost reduction, operational efficiency, and supply chain improvement, while serving as a procurement subject matter expert and supporting cross-functional sourcing and operational initiatives.
This position will also be supporting the company’s operating model (SOAR) and contributing to the organization’s business value drivers, Profitable New Business, Productivity, Precision M&A, and Value-Based Pricing, through operational excellence, continuous improvement, collaboration, and customer focus.
